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of pressure vessel technology, specifically a pressure vessel with a sealing structure. Background Technology
[0002] The main function of electrically heated pressure vessels is to heat and maintain the temperature of the substances inside the vessel, ensuring safety and efficiency in the production process. Electrically heated pressure vessels convert electrical energy into heat energy through heating elements, thereby heating the substances inside the vessel to the required temperature. Temperature controllers are responsible for monitoring and controlling the temperature, preventing it from becoming too high or too low, ensuring the safety and stability of the production process. Existing pressure vessels have poor sealing at the connection between the sealing cap and the vessel body, easily leading to leaks and unnecessary losses. Furthermore, existing pressure vessels directly release excess pressure during use, which, if the internal gas is highly pungent, can negatively impact environmental quality. Utility Model Content
[0003] The purpose of this utility model is to provide a pressure vessel with a sealing structure to solve the problems mentioned in the background art, such as poor sealing effect at the connection between the sealing cover and the pressure vessel body of existing pressure vessels, easy leakage, causing unnecessary losses, and the direct discharge of excess pressure during use, which affects environmental quality if the internal gas is highly pungent.

[0024] Please see Figure 1-5 This utility model provides a technical solution: a pressure vessel with a sealing structure, such as... Figure 1 , Figure 2 , Figure 4 and Figure 5 As shown, the pressure vessel structure 1 includes a pressure vessel shell 11. A sealing cover 13 is detachably installed on the upper side of the pressure vessel shell 11. A cleaning scraper assembly 12 is fixed on the sealing cover 13. A pressure relief pipe 14 passes through the sealing cover 13. An electric heating wire 15 is embedded inside the pressure vessel shell 11. The cleaning scraper assembly 12 includes a motor housing 121. A motor in the motor housing 121 drives a rotating rod 122 to rotate. The rotation of the rotating rod 122 causes the scraper plate 123 to rotate.
[0025] Among them, a control device for controlling the overall equipment is fixed on the outer shell 11 of the pressure vessel, a support rod is fixed on the outer shell 11 of the pressure vessel, a base is fixed inside the support rod through an electric telescopic rod, and a universal roller is fixed inside the base through an electric telescopic rod, thereby ensuring that the entire device can move.
[0026] Specifically, there are two sets of scraper blades 123, which are symmetrically arranged. There are also two sets of pressure relief pipes 14. The left pressure relief pipe 14 is used to relieve pressure when the pressure inside the pressure vessel is too high, while the right pressure relief pipe 14 is used for normal pressure relief. An automatic gate valve is embedded in the pressure relief pipe 14.
[0027] Furthermore, a high-pressure nozzle is embedded in the sealing cover 13. The high-pressure nozzle is connected to the water tank through a water supply pipe. There are multiple sets of high-pressure nozzles. The pressurized cleaning water enters multiple sets of high-pressure nozzles through the water supply pipe. With the assistance of multiple sets of high-pressure nozzles, the inside of the pressure vessel shell 11 is cleaned to ensure the cleaning effect.
[0028] In the above scheme, the sealing cover 13 is placed on the outer shell 11 of the pressure vessel and fixed with bolts. With the assistance of the motor in the motor box 121, the scraper 123 on the rotating rod 122 is rotated. The rotation of the rotating rod 122 drives the scraper 123 to rotate and clean the inner wall of the outer shell 11 of the pressure vessel. With the assistance of the electric heating wire 15, the internal liquid is heated. The generated high-temperature gas enters the exhaust gas purification structure 3 through the right pressure relief pipe 14 for treatment.
[0029] like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 4 As shown, a sealing structure 2 is embedded in the pressure vessel structure 1. The sealing structure 2 includes a sealing component 21, which is located between O-rings 22. The sealing component 21 includes a limiting protrusion 211, which is wrapped with a sealing strip 212 and embedded in a sealing groove 213. The sealing groove 213 is formed on the outer shell 11 of the pressure vessel.
[0030] The sealing component 21 is arranged in a ring shape;
[0031] In the above scheme, the sealing strip 212 on the limiting protrusion 211 is embedded in the sealing groove 213, and the O-ring 22 is placed at the required position between the pressure vessel shell 11 and the sealing cover 13, thereby ensuring the sealing effect.
[0032] like Figure 1 , Figure 2 , Figure 3 and Figure 5 As shown, the pressure vessel structure 1 is connected to the exhaust gas purification structure 3 and is used for exhaust gas treatment. The exhaust gas purification structure 3 includes an adsorption component 31, which is connected to a cooling component 33 through an air inlet pipe 32. The adsorption component 31 includes a first adsorption box 311, which is slidably connected to an activated carbon mesh 312. The first adsorption box 311 is connected to a second adsorption box 313. The cooling component 33 includes a cooling box 331, which is connected to a cooling fan 332. The air inlet pipe 32 is connected to a gas delivery pipe 333, which is located inside the cooling box 331. A heat-conducting plate 334 is provided between the gas delivery pipes 333.
[0033] The activated carbon mesh 312 is provided in two sets with different mesh densities. Multiple sets of activated carbon packs are placed in the second adsorption box 313 to ensure the adsorption effect.
[0034] Specifically, multiple cooling fans 332 are connected to the cooling box 331. The air inlet pipe 32 is connected to three small air supply pipes 333 through a conversion pipe. The air supply pipes 333 are embedded in the cooling box 331 in a serpentine shape, thereby extending the time for air blowing and heat dissipation.
[0035] Furthermore, the cooling box 331 is equipped with a scalding protection net to prevent burns to workers.
[0036] In the above scheme, the gas inside the pressure vessel shell 11 enters the first adsorption box 311 through the right pressure relief pipe 14, and undergoes adsorption treatment with the assistance of activated carbon mesh 312. It then undergoes adsorption treatment again with the assistance of activated carbon packs in the second adsorption box 313. The treated gas enters the gas delivery pipe 333 in the cooling box 331 through the gas inlet pipe 32, and undergoes heat absorption treatment with the assistance of heat conduction plate 334. It then undergoes cooling treatment with the assistance of multiple cooling fans 332 on the cooling box 331 to avoid excessively high exhaust temperature and burns to operators. A water cooling device is inserted in the gas delivery pipe 333 to achieve cooling and ensure the cooling effect.
[0037] Working principle: When using this pressure vessel with a sealed structure, an external power supply is connected, and the internal temperature is raised through the setting of pressure vessel structure 1. The sealing effect of pressure vessel structure 1 is ensured by the setting of sealing structure 2, and the exhaust gas is treated by the setting of exhaust gas purification structure 3.
